A few weeks ago. My cars blower wouldnt work. Then while driving down the road the horn and wiper fluid would spray and beep in unison in and erratic way. Then today while replacing the rear brakes the same thing. The horn was blowing and the sprayers were squirting fluid at the same time and again in a erratic way. It stopped when i smack my hand on the fuse box under the hood which was already open. The doors locked and the car wasnt running and the keys were in my pocket.....We had it at the garage in between these too incidents and they couldnt determine the problem?????

Get a full scan done to see if you can find any trouble codes.

The can bus system seems to have a malfunction causing the problem.

It sounds like either a CAN BUS issue or a short circuit in the fuse box. You'll need to get a full scan, not just a CEL scan, but all codes.
